About the course
This online live interactive insurance webinar is designed for the more experienced individual who may be looking to discuss current Directors’ & Officers’ Liability insurance issues and/or be seeking a refresher on D&O insurance.
The webinar will be highly interactive with delegate participation and engagement throughout. This half day course consists of two 90 minute on-line sessions with a 15 minute break.
This webinar looks to build on elements which would have been covered in Introductory and Intermediate level courses.
The webinar aims to explore in detail certain elements of Directors’ & Officers’ Liability Insurance. Delegates are invited to complete a pre-course questionnaire highlighting their areas of interest. The course will be tailored accordingly. The details below are subject to those amendments.
The webinar is delivered by a Chartered Insurance Broker with over 40 years insurance experience who is a certified on-line facilitator (COLF).
Course Objectives
By successfully completing this webinar, delegates should be able to:
- Explain the major duties of directors
- Explain in detail what D&O insurance covers.
- Identify the underwriting considerations for D&O insurance.
- Describe legal issues arising from recent legislation and court cases
- Discuss current developments and trends in the Directors and Officers Liability insurance market
